SB21

Provides relative to payments toward the unfunded accrued liability of the Louisiana State Employees' Retirement System and the amortization of certain actuarial gains. (gov sig) (EN SEE ACTUARIAL NOTE FC)

Louisiana SB21 amends the Louisiana State Employees' Retirement System's payment and amortization rules. It modifies the calculation of employer contributions and minimum employer contribution rates. The bill repeals provisions related to the amortization of the unfunded accrued liability and the treatment of contribution variances. It also changes the calculation of the secondary priority amount and residual priority amount. The changes are effective upon the governor's signature or lapse of time for gubernatorial action.
